Standard installations modify system registries, generate user profile directories, and lock dependencies to a specific operating system. Portable versions bypass this infrastructure by utilizing a runtime wrapper or a virtualization layer. When a user launches a portable application, the wrapper intercepts system calls and redirects registry edits or file creation to a localized folder within the application's directory.

Typically packed into a single executable file ( .exe ) or a standalone folder, Macromedia Flash 8 Portable is designed to run directly from a USB flash drive, an external hard drive, or a cloud storage folder.
